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4890893 26761 402322 408306417
082739577 51451 10
082739577 51451 10
496811 751 8737
All about undefined
Interested in learning more?
082739577 51451 10
496811 751 8737
See more
273 03 14726331
7677425469 66860 14 81
See more
27 504
048950 5106 70 04589280 8575206
See more